Satu: Apakah itu pemalar
Selepas nilai pemalar ditakrifkan, ia tidak boleh ditukar di tempat lain dalam skrip
Pemalar ialah pengecam sesuatu nilai mudah , pemalar terdiri daripada huruf Inggeris, garis bawah dan nombor, tetapi nombor tidak boleh muncul sebagai huruf pertama. (Nama pemalar tidak perlu ditambah dengan pengubah $)
Nota: Pemalar boleh digunakan sepanjang skrip
Dua: Tetapkan pemalar php
Gunakan fungsi define()
Format sintaks:
bool define ( string $name , $value bercampur [, bool $case_insensitive = false ] )
Fungsi define mempunyai 3 parameter
1.name: parameter yang diperlukan, nama pemalar, iaitu pengecam
2.value: parameter yang diperlukan, nilai pemalar
3 . Lalai adalah sensitif huruf besar/kecil
<?php header("Content-type: text/html; charset=utf-8"); // 区分大小写的常量名 define("GREETING", "欢迎访问 taobao.com"); echo GREETING; // 输出 "欢迎访问 taobao.com" echo '<br>'; echo greeting; // 输出 "greeting" ?>
Nota: Ini sensitif huruf besar/kecil, jadi ralat akan dilaporkan
Mari tulis ralat tidak sensitif huruf besar/kecil
<?php header("Content-type: text/html; charset=utf-8"); // 不区分大小写的常量名 define("GREETING", "欢迎访问 taobao.com", true); echo greeting; // 输出 "欢迎访问taobao.com" ?>
Nota: Ini akan mengeluarkan "Selamat Datang ke taobao.com" tanpa melaporkan ralat
Malar boleh berada di luar tanpa tanda petikan hanya Skalar boleh digunakan
<?php header("Content-type: text/html; charset=utf-8"); // 不区分大小写的常量名 define("GREETING",array(1,2,1,1)); echo greeting; // 输出 "欢迎访问淘宝" ?>
Selain itu, sistem juga telah menyediakan beberapa pemalar terbina dalam untuk kita seperti yang ditunjukkan dalam rajah di bawah
bahagian seterusnya